HomeLOCALCabinet Proposal to Construct Two Coal Power Plants Rejected Cabinet Proposal to Construct Two Coal Power Plants Rejected Dec 20, 2017byFastnews Dr.Sarath Amunugama and Rajith Siyambalapitiya have jointly submitted a cabinet paper proposing to construct two coal power plants of 600 mega watts each. This cabinet proposal was rejected by the cabinet yesterday (19).
